Recognizing Usual Home Appliance Concerns
When your appliances instantly quit working, it can feel overwhelming, particularly if you're unclear what the issue is. Comprehending usual appliance problems can aid you identify issues promptly. As an example, if your fridge isn't cooling, check the temperature setups and make certain it's plugged in. A defective door seal can additionally cause cooling down issues.If your washing equipment will not spin, check the lid switch; it usually obtains harmed and avoids procedure. A dishwashing machine that doesn't drain could be a clogged filter or a damaged pump, so analyze those parts first.For stoves, burners that won't spark could require cleaning or call for a new igniter. Constantly listen for unusual sounds or see if any kind of mistake codes appear, as these can lead you towards the service. By identifying these indications, you'll be much better geared up to take on appliance fixings efficiently.

Standard Troubleshooting Techniques
Numerous typical device problems can be solved with a few basic troubleshooting methods. Begin by inspecting the power supply; validate your device is connected in and the outlet is functioning. If it's not activating, try resetting the breaker. Next off, pay attention for unusual sounds or scents, which can indicate a problem. Do not forget to clean filters and vents, as dirt buildup can affect performance.If you're handling a fridge, examine the temperature level settings and verify the door seals securely. For cleaning equipments, make certain the tons isn't out of balance and the tubes are connected correctly. If your device has mistake codes, seek advice from the customer guidebook for advice. Lastly, record any type of problems you see, as this can assist determine patterns and help in fixings. With these methods, you can commonly determine and settle minor issues prior to they rise.
Necessary Tools for Home Appliance Fixing
Having the right devices available can make troubleshooting and fixing your appliances a lot easier. Begin with a fundamental toolkit, including a screwdriver set with both flathead and Phillips heads, pliers, and a wrench. These devices will certainly aid you tackle most screws and bolts you encounter.Next, consider a multimeter for screening electrical parts. It's important for detecting problems in devices like washers and dryers. Furthermore, a degree can assure your devices are appropriately lined up, stopping additional problems.Don' t neglect a flashlight-- working in dim spaces can be difficult. Security gear, such as handwear covers and safety glasses, is essential to secure yourself throughout repairs.Finally, having a vacuum cleaner or shop vac accessible will certainly aid you tidy up any type of particles that accumulates during the repair work process. With these crucial tools, you'll be well-prepared to handle most device repair services with confidence.

Knowing When to Call an Expert
While tackling a DIY repair service can be satisfying, knowing when to call an expert is essential for preventing additional damage or security threats. If you experience intricate problems, like electrical problems or gas leaks, don't think twice to connect for help. These scenarios can be hazardous if handled improperly.Additionally, if you've attempted repairing the device however it's still malfunctioning, it's an indication you might require an expert. Continuing to repair without the ideal expertise can exacerbate the problem.When you discover unusual sounds or smells, it's ideal to seek advice from a specialist right away. Neglecting these indicators may result in expensive repair work down the line.Finally, if your device is still under guarantee, calling a service technician guarantees you will not void it. Identifying your limits maintains both you and your devices safe, enabling you to prevent unneeded stress and irritation.
Routine Maintenance to avoid Break Downs
Addressing appliance problems immediately is very important, but regular upkeep can considerably decrease the regularity of those troubles. Start by cleansing your home appliances routinely; dust and crud can cause them to work more difficult and wear quicker. For fridges, check the door seals for leaks and tidy the coils a minimum of two times a year. For washing makers, maintain the door seal tidy to avoid mold and mildew and mildew.Don' t forget to check and change filters in dishwashing machines, air conditioners, and dryers as required. This ensures peak efficiency and power performance. On a website regular basis check pipes and cables for damage, and replace them if necessary.Lastly, think about maintaining an upkeep timetable to advise yourself of these jobs. By committing a little time to regular checks, you'll not only extend the life of your appliances but likewise save cash on costly repair work later on.
